Madison Keys v Varvara Gracheva: Preview
Madison Keys began her 2025 season on a phenomenal note back in January. In the final of the Happy Slam at the Rod Laver Arena, she outperformed World No.1 Aryna Sabalenka to capture a maiden major title. Later, she had to a take a month-long break because of a leg injury. Upon her return, Keys continued to show solid form at the Indian Wells. She reached the semis before Sabalenka stopped her while taking the revenge of her AO defeat with a brutal score line of 6-0, 6-1.
The result against Sabalenka seems to have affected Keys’ form in subsequent events. In Miami, she crashed out in R32 after 19-year-old sensation Alexandra Eala bested her in straight sets. Then in Charleston, Russian pro Anna Kalinskaya beat her, in R16, with a score line of 6-2, 6-4. However, Keys regained her rhythm on Madrid’s clay surface, reaching the quarterfinal stage. But former World No.1 Iga Swiatek stopped her campaign eventually with a score line of 0-6, 6-3, 6-2.
Speaking of her opponent, Frenchwoman Varvara Gracheva’s 2025 season has been forgettable at best. Back in January, she was ousted in R32 of the Hobart International. Then down under, Germany’s Eva Lys ousted her early, in second round, with a score line of 6-2, 3-6, 6-4. Going into the Winners Open, she couldn’t move past R32 after losing to American Peyton Stearns. Then at the ATX Open, too, she was ousted early after losing against American Caroline Dolehide in R16.
In her next five campaigns, too, Gracheva failed to create an impact. At the Indian Wells Masters, Miami Open, Charleston Open, Rouen, and Madrid Open, she was edged out in R64, R128, R32, R16, and R128 respectively. In the Italian Open this week, she began her stint on a winning note, defeating Aussie Ajla Tomljanović in straight sets (6-3, 6-4).
Keys v Gracheva: Head-to-Head
Both players haven’t met in any WTA event so far. Currently, the h2h tally stands at 0-0. Thursday’s match will mark their maiden face-off on the professional level.
Prediction: Madison Keys to win in straight sets
Madison Keys is miles ahead of her French counterpart in terms of singles stats this season. With a staggering win percentage of 82.14, the 2025 Australian Open queen has won 23 of her 28 matches so far. In comparison, Varvara Gracheva has clinched just six victories out of her 15 encounters.
Coming onto event history, Keys has had a long experience at the Italian Open. This week she will be competing in the WTA 1000 event for 12th time. Her best run in Rome came almost a decade ago, in 2016. She managed to reach the summit clash before 23-time slam queen Serena Williams beat her with a score line of 7-6(5), 6-3. In her last appearance (2024), Keys was able to reach the QF stage before Swiatek ended her campaign with a straight-set win. On the other hand, Gracheva’s not been able to impress on the Roman clay court. In last two appearances (2023 and 2024), the French pro crashed out in R128 and then R64.
But what about their playing styles? Well, Keys is known for her aggressive approach using powerful strokes. She prefers to dominate her opponents from the baseline. She also relies on her first serves to earn crucial points. Also watch out for her amazing forehand shots. Speaking of Gracheva, she’s known for her calm and composed approach on the court. She likes to get advantage from the baseline using effective groundstrokes.
Taking the overall form from 2025 into consideration, Madison Keys looks to be the clear favorite in Thursday’s face-off. The American is expected to advance into R32 at the Italian Open with a straight-set win over Gracheva.
